Do people with borderline personality disorder like attention?

People with BPD may often have dramatic, emotional, erratic, and attention-seeking moods. This behavior is severe enough to cause problems with family and work life, long-term planning, and sense of self.

Are people with BPD independent?

Because you lack the vocabularies for your feelings, you end up letting them fester inside of you. Many people with quiet BPD appear independent, successful, and high functioning. You may be capable at work during the day, but collapse when you get home.

What is manipulation in borderline personality disorder?

Borderline Personality Disorder. The word “manipulation” implies skillful and malicious intent, but more often than not, these behaviors are usually just desperate, unskilled attempts by someone with BPD to get emotional needs met that were neglected in an abusive or invalidating upbringing.

Why do people with BPD have so many emotional outbursts?

For example, Kreisman and Straus wrote that people with BPD appear to have been born with a hyperreactive fear system, or their fear system became hyperreactive in response to early fear-provoking trauma, or both. This could explain some of the emotional outbursts that seem disproportionate to the provocation.
